For the record: the Larkspool orders table is now partitioned by month. We backfilled twelve months of historical partitions, swapped the view over during Saturday's window, and dropped the monolithic table after a 48-hour soak. Query latency on date-bounded reports dropped roughly 70%. The partition-maintenance job creates next month's partition on the 25th and detaches anything older than 18 months. If you inherit this system, note that everything hinges on the maintenance job's settings, reproduced below.

settings of fafog-haduf:
ZORIX_PIN=4648
ZORIX_METRICS_HOST=metrics.zorix.paliqsys.corp
ZORIX_LOG_LEVEL=info
ZORIX_TENANT=druix

Waveform Preview API — Echomark

The preview endpoint renders a downsampled waveform image for an uploaded audio asset. Requests are read-only, scoped per asset, and rate-limited to 60/minute. No raw audio leaves the rendering tier; only PNG output is returned. All calls require TLS 1.3 and a short-lived bearer credential scoped to preview access, such as the one below.

session JWT of yawep-yawep = eyJhbGciOiJIUzI1NiIsInR5cCI6IkpXVCJ9.eyJzdWIiOiI3pWF3_In0.aXYsHiog

**Key ceremony checklist — item 12: Fieldnote offline mode**

Before signing the Fieldnote release build, verify that offline mode is fully functional on the ceremony device. Load the survey bundle, disable all radios, and confirm that form entry, photo capture, and GPS logging continue without errors. Sync queue must show pending items, not failures. This check matters because field crews in remote areas depend on it entirely. Once verified, unlock the signing enclave using the passphrase below.

unlock words, hahip-baduf: holwyn-istath-julvan

Review note for on-call awareness: this change makes the Tallyfern loyalty-points ledger write compensating entries instead of mutating balances in place, so reconciliation can replay history safely. Two cautions: replay is idempotent only if the dedupe window covers your retry horizon, and the batch flusher will hold points in memory briefly — watch heap during peak redemption events. If the flusher backs up, tune rather than restart. Current defaults are defined below.

tuning constants:
QUOTAS = {
    "druwyn": 5,
    "holix": 5,
    "zorath": 5,
    "holwyn": 10,
}